I got a few new Warlord Japanese (SNLF) and US Marines plastic spues, 8 medium mortars (for my Marines and Japanese), 4 Japanese HMG's and a field office set. 

The Assault Group produce really good individual weapons - they provided the mortars and HMGs.  Its a great great way to supplement/support your armies. I also got several figure packs from them via Santa! 

The build to date is looking like this..

28mm Japanese HMG and mortar position with all the usual foliage added I went a little larger than normal just to give it some table space.

28mm Japanese Bunker

It has a nice low profile but I did hide a couple of magnets in there ground cover (middle and far left) just in case I would like a few palm trees (with magnets) added later.

The mortar from the rear.


The HMG has a nice low profile well protected look.



So next up I then mounted some (3 off) smaller support teams (made from a mix of plastic and metal figures) onto mdf circles to offer a variety of options.
